Our Air Quality & Sanitizing Services in Glendale

Mold Treatment

Glendale’s combination of vintage construction and winter rain creates ideal conditions for mold in duct systems. We’ve treated mold in Adams Hill homes where poorly sealed crawl spaces allowed moisture into 1920s floor joist cavities, and in Rossmoyne attics where original galvanized ductwork developed condensation in uninsulated runs. Our process includes source identification, mechanical removal with HEPA-contained Rotobrush agitation, and application of EPA-registered antimicrobial. A typical mold treatment in Glendale runs $340–$580 for residential systems, with multi-unit buildings quoted per unit.

Bacteria Sanitizing

Post-wildfire bacterial contamination is a recurring issue we address in Glendale hillside homes. When Santa Ana winds push smoke and ash through the Verdugo Mountain corridors, combustion particulates carry microbial contaminants that standard cleaning misses. We apply hospital-grade sanitizing agents through the entire duct ecosystem — supply and return — using Nikro fogging equipment that penetrates where surface wiping can’t. Bacteria sanitizing following fire-season cleaning typically adds $180–$290 to a standard duct cleaning in Glendale.

Odor Removal

Persistent odors in Glendale homes usually trace to three sources: wildfire smoke particulates embedded in porous duct insulation, pet dander accumulation in undersized return systems, or mold metabolites in moisture-compromised runs. We don’t mask odors — we eliminate them through source removal, oxidative treatment, and in severe cases, insulation replacement. The 91201 corridor near the 134 freeway presents a distinct challenge: diesel particulate infiltration that creates a persistent “hot asphalt” smell in return ducts. Our odor removal protocol addresses this with activated carbon filtration integration.

UV Light Installation

UV-C germicidal lights installed at the coil and return plenum destroy mold spores, bacteria, and viruses on contact — critical for Glendale homes that repeatedly cycle wildfire particulates. We specify Honeywell and Aprilaire UV systems sized to your air handler’s CFM rating, not generic wattage guesses. Installation in a typical Glendale residential system runs $380–$520, including electrical connection and bulb replacement scheduling. For homes in the 91208 ZIP above Glenoaks Canyon, we often pair UV with whole-house air purifiers given the repeated smoke exposure.

Technician installing UV light air sanitizer in HVAC system in Glendale, CA

Allergen Reduction

Glendale’s dense urban tree canopy — oak, sycamore, and eucalyptus — produces pollen loads that overwhelm standard HVAC filtration. Combined with pet dander in multi-generational households and the fine mineral dust the Verdugo winds deposit, allergen accumulation in Glendale ducts exceeds what flatland communities experience. Our allergen reduction service combines mechanical extraction, HEPA filtration upgrade consultation, and optional Aprilaire whole-house purifier integration. We see particular demand in spring and fall, when Santa Ana events overlap with peak pollen.

Air Purifier Install

For homes near the 134 and 2 freeway corridors, standalone room purifiers are insufficient — diesel particulate and brake dust infiltrates the entire duct system. We install Honeywell and Aprilaire whole-house electronic air cleaners that integrate directly with your existing air handler, treating every cubic foot of circulated air. A typical whole-house purifier installation in Glendale runs $640–$1,100 depending on air handler accessibility and electrical requirements.

Common Air Quality & Sanitizing Problems We See in Glendale Homes

  • Asbestos-wrap ducts in pre-1960 hillside homes. Original 1940s–1950s duct runs in homes above Glenoaks Canyon and in the 91208 ZIP are often insulated with asbestos-containing wrap. Out-of-area contractors disturb this material without pre-testing, creating hazardous airborne fiber conditions. We test before touching anything — legally required, and non-negotiable for us.
  • Shallow ceiling cavities in mid-century apartments. Central Glendale’s 1950s–1960s multi-unit buildings in the 91201–91204 ZIPs have retrofit duct systems crammed into ceiling spaces as shallow as 4–6 inches. Standard vacuum trucks can’t access these runs; our Nikro slim-profile tools can, and do.
  • Repeated wildfire smoke infiltration. Glendale’s position at the base of the Verdugo Mountains creates a natural funnel for Santa Ana wind-driven smoke and ash. Unlike Burbank on the valley floor, hillside homes here pull combustion particulates directly into HVAC returns during fire season — making post-fire cleaning a recurring need, not a one-time fix.
  • Unsealed duct penetrations in vintage Craftsman homes. After cleaning 1920s homes in Adams Hill, we frequently find original wall and floor penetrations never properly sealed. Santa Ana wind-driven soil dust from the Verdugo foothills recontaminates these systems within weeks unless we seal as part of the service.
